Pre-Alarm Earthquakes

  • Resonance is a general phenomenon as well as in earthquakes. When a large shock bursts its wave will cause resonance of an earthquake source being pregnant with a shock at later stage. Energy absorbed from earthquake wave is not so much, but the wave can be a sign of earthquake pregnanting progress. That is an alarm signal. The large shock sending signals is called alarm earthquake. The earthquake wave are anisotropy, and the earthquake belt, latitude and longitude are superior in intensities to other directions. There were pre alarm earthquakes in some big earthquakes that damaged cities, such as the earthquake of magnitude 7 8 in Tangshan,the earthquake of magnitude 8 5 in Haiyuan and the earthquake of magnitude 8 2 in Japan Guandong. The pre alarm earthquakes can play an important part in quakeproof in the regions where big earthquakes maybe take place.
